Make-ahead tip: You can make the cherry butter up to one week in advance. Keep the butter refrigerated until about 30 minutes before you want to serve it. Let it sit at room temperature to allow it to soften into a spreadable consistency. If you try to spread cold butter on cornbread (or any bread, for that matter!), you’re going to end up with a disappointing pile of crumbs.

Whisk wet ingredients together

In a large bowl, whisk together egg, milk and oil until the mixture is light and fluffy. This will incorporate some air into the dry ingredients and help the baking powder leaven the cornbread.

Add in dry ingredients to form a batter

Stir in salt, sugar and baking powder until incorporated. Slowly add flour and cornmeal, alternating 1/2 cup of each at a time and mixing until just combined.

Gluten-free cornbread with cherry butter

Yield 4 servings

Ingredients

Cornbread:

  • 1 egg
  • 3/4 cup 2% or whole milk
  • 1/3 cup canola oil
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on baking powder
  • 1 cup all-purpose gluten-free flour
  • 1 cup cornmeal

Cherry butter:

  • 1/2 cup fresh cherries, pitted
  • 1/3 cup water
  • 1/3 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/3 cup butter, softened to room temperature

Instructions

Cornbread:

  1. Preheat oven to 375F.
  2. In large bowl, whisk together egg, milk and oil until light and fluffy.
  3. Add salt, sugar and baking powder. Mix until combined.
  4. Slowly add flour and cornmeal, alternating 1/2 cup at a time. Mix until just combined. Do not overmix.
  5. Grease 9-inch square baking dish.
  6. Pour batter into baking dish and bake for 20 to 25 minutes.

Cherry butter:

  1. In small pan over medium heat, combine cherries, water and sugar. Simmer until cherries are soft.
  2. Pour cherries into small colander fitted over bowl. Transfer cherries to bowl to cool. Reserve simple syrup in bowl for another use.
  3. In food processor, combine butter and cherries. Pulse until well blended.
  4. Place cherry butter in refrigerator until 30 minutes before serving.
  5. Allow cherry butter to come to room temperature.
  6. Serve butter with cornbread.
